logo

主流CDN加速器解析:技术选型与场景适配指南

作者:宇宙中心我曹县2025.09.16 19:08浏览量:0

简介:本文系统梳理主流CDN加速器的技术架构、应用场景及选型建议,通过对比分析帮助开发者选择最适合的加速方案,提升全球内容分发效率。

一、CDN加速器的核心价值与技术原理

CDN(Content Delivery Network)加速器通过分布式节点架构,将内容缓存至离用户最近的边缘节点,有效解决网络延迟、带宽瓶颈和单点故障问题。其技术核心包含四层:

  1. 智能调度系统:基于DNS解析或HTTP DNS技术,结合用户地理位置、网络质量、节点负载等20+维度数据,实现毫秒级节点路由决策。例如某CDN的调度系统可处理每秒百万级请求,准确率达99.9%。
  2. 动态路由优化:采用BGP Anycast技术实现节点间链路优化,某厂商测试数据显示,跨运营商访问延迟可降低40-60ms。
  3. 多级缓存架构:包含L1(边缘节点)、L2(区域中心)、L3(源站)三级缓存,命中率直接影响加速效果。行业平均缓存命中率约85%,头部厂商可达92%以上。
  4. 协议优化技术:支持HTTP/2、QUIC等现代协议,某测试表明QUIC协议可使弱网环境下首屏加载时间缩短35%。

二、主流CDN加速器分类与对比

(一)通用型CDN加速器

代表产品:阿里云CDN、腾讯云CDN、AWS CloudFront
技术特点

  • 全球2500+节点覆盖,支持静态/动态内容加速
  • 集成WAFDDoS防护安全功能
  • 提供实时监控大屏,支持秒级流量调度
    适用场景
  • 电商网站商品图片加速(某电商平台使用后页面打开速度提升60%)
  • 新闻资讯类APP内容分发(某客户端延迟从2.3s降至0.8s)
    选型建议
  • 优先选择具备GSLB全局负载均衡能力的产品
  • 关注是否支持IPv6双栈接入
  • 考察API接口丰富度(需支持至少10种管理接口)

(二)视频流媒体专用CDN

代表产品:网宿科技视频CDN、Akamai Media Delivery
技术特点

  • 支持HLS/DASH等流媒体协议
  • 具备码率自适应(ABR)能力
  • 提供首屏加速、卡顿优化等专项功能
    性能指标
  • 某直播平台测试显示,卡顿率从3.2%降至0.7%
  • 平均首屏打开时间从1.2s缩短至0.4s
    实施要点
  • 需配置多级缓存策略(热点内容L1缓存命中率>90%)
  • 建议启用协议优化(如HTTP/2 Server Push)
  • 监控指标应包含缓冲次数、平均码率等专项数据

(三)游戏加速专用CDN

代表产品:腾讯云游戏CDN、华为云游戏加速
技术特点

  • 支持TCP/UDP协议加速
  • 具备动态路由优化能力
  • 提供弱网对抗(抗丢包率>30%)
    案例数据
  • 某MOBA游戏使用后延迟标准差降低45%
  • 回合制游戏操作响应时间从280ms降至120ms
    配置建议
  • 端口范围建议配置1024-65535
  • 启用TCP BBR拥塞控制算法
  • 设置QoS优先级标记(DSCP值建议设为46)

(四)API与动态加速CDN

代表产品:Fastly、Cloudflare Workers
技术特点

  • 支持边缘计算(Edge Computing)
  • 提供实时数据修改能力
  • 具备API网关功能
    性能优势
  • 某金融APP使用后API响应时间从1.2s降至300ms
  • 动态内容加速效率提升3-5倍
    开发指南
  • 需配置VCL(Varnish Configuration Language)脚本
  • 建议启用ESI(Edge Side Includes)缓存
  • 监控指标应包含边缘函数执行时间等专项数据

三、CDN选型决策框架

(一)业务需求匹配度评估

  1. 内容类型:静态资源(图片/CSS)优先通用CDN,动态API需选择支持边缘计算的产品
  2. 用户分布:出海业务需考察海外节点覆盖率(建议北美/欧洲节点占比>40%)
  3. 安全需求:金融类应用需选择支持国密算法、等保三级认证的CDN

(二)技术指标对比表

指标 通用型CDN 视频CDN 游戏CDN 动态CDN
节点数量 2000+ 1500+ 800+ 500+
缓存命中率 85-92% 80-88% 75-85% 70-80%
协议支持 HTTP/2 HLS UDP QUIC
平均延迟 50-150ms 80-200ms 30-100ms 20-80ms

(三)成本优化策略

  1. 按量付费:适合波动型业务,某厂商单价约0.05元/GB
  2. 资源包:预付费模式,折扣率可达30-50%
  3. 混合部署:核心业务用高端CDN,非关键流量用性价比方案

四、实施与运维最佳实践

(一)配置优化方案

  1. 回源策略:设置多源站(主备源站延迟<50ms)
  2. 缓存规则
    1. # 示例缓存配置
    2. location /static/ {
    3. expires 30d;
    4. add_header Cache-Control "public";
    5. }
  3. HTTPS优化:启用OCSP Stapling减少握手时间

(二)监控体系构建

  1. 核心指标
    • 带宽使用率(建议<80%)
    • 5xx错误率(应<0.1%)
    • 缓存命中率(目标>85%)
  2. 告警阈值
    • 延迟突增>50%触发告警
    • 错误率连续3分钟>0.5%升级事件

(三)故障应急处理

  1. 节点故障:立即切换至备用节点(GSLB响应时间<1s)
  2. 源站故障:启用预热缓存或降级方案
  3. DDoS攻击:自动切换至清洗中心(防护容量应>500Gbps)

五、未来发展趋势

  1. AI驱动调度:某厂商已实现基于机器学习的流量预测,准确率达92%
  2. 5G边缘计算:预计2025年30% CDN节点将部署在MEC平台
  3. 零信任架构:Gartner预测2027年75% CDN将集成持续验证机制

结语:选择CDN加速器需综合考量业务特性、技术指标和成本效益。建议通过POC测试验证关键指标(如延迟、命中率),并建立完善的监控体系。随着边缘计算和AI技术的发展,CDN正在从内容分发平台进化为智能计算网络,开发者应持续关注技术演进方向。

相关文章推荐

发表评论